Relationship between distribution characteristics of grasshoppers and habitat in the Heihe River Basin

Abstract
By using field investigation and quantitative analysis,we studied the correlation between grasshopper composition,ecological species groups and habitat in different grassland of the middle and upper reaches of the river Heihe.Results indicated that terrain,climate condition,soil and vegetation composition have significant heterogeneity in middle and upper reaches of the river Heihe,a total of 38 grasshopper species belonging to 11 genera and 3 families were captured during continuous four years,32 more-area-distributed grasshopper species were classified as 8 ecological species groups when the correlation coefficient is 0.5.Grasshoppers have very widely ecological adaption,meanwhile grassland habitat determinate geographical distribution patterns of grasshoppers,grasshoppers in the researched region mainly distribute at the altitude range of 2000~3000 meters of Qilian Mountains.Temperature is the promoting factor to grasshopper species composition,while other factors are inhibitors;Temperature and precipitation are the promoting factors to grasshopper density.The correlation between extreme minimum temperature and grasshopper species composition is very significant(r=0.706,0.761,p0.01),and exists a significant correlation with grasshopper density(r=0.665,p0.05).
